The final showing of the old Century Cinema at the foot of Wyle Cop in Shrewsbury, before it disappears completely thanks to demolition in August 2002. The building had opened as the Kings Hall Cinema on March 12, 1914. The Century turned to bingo and finally closed in 1973, and became a domestic appliance store. The cleared site was redeveloped as flats.
